I love the Hangsen tobacs, highway, desert ship and No5. I got all 3 in glass steeped ready to vape plus a backup of each also steeping. I built 60 mls(60vg/40pg) initially then when ready, remove 50 and leave 10 to seed the next batch so I always have 60mls onhand along with using a magnetic mixer to do my stirring I've had nothing but success with my 6% tobac mixes. Warming up the vg/pg base in hot water also helps incorporate the flavors better, mix then let the air bubbles subside overnight, rewarm, remix with as little air as possible to avoid oxidizing the nic.
I did buy a small Tab Blend but IMO its too sweet and has a caramel tone in which doesn't appeal to me. None of the other tobaccos from other companies has yet to appeal to me either, some too sweet, chemical tasting or have that rancid after taste that is simply YUK
I haven't yet bothered to make a complex formula but make all my flavors as stand alones then blend then together, let steep, adjust to get the flavors to pop. A Tobacco Absolute(s) along with acetyl pyrazine are must haves if you want to have a full satisfying experience with tobacco blends if your looking to create your all day tobac vape.

A new flavor I make 20mls without the nic, taste then let steep a few days, remix then taste again to decide on next step. I taste as a drop on the back of the hand, since it has no nic there is no back of the tongue bitter from the nic.
I think the taste out of the atty should be almost what a drop on the hand would taste like, thats how I gauge the flavors. I then add nic to a few mls and try it in a atty to see if it tastes like it smells, then go from there.

There is no such thing as hangsen 555 - hangsen brand "555" "state express" is highway and only highway.

Pass go and buy the highway right now.

Highway is what you want, it is 100% highway. Not no.5 not tab, just highway.

Buy fresh highway and mix it at 3.33%. 1ml / 30ml base. Shake a few times over an hour. Try it out!! If you think you would like it stronger give it a few days, then add a little more flavoring to bump it up to 4%

Since the vendor calls it 555 I assume they are mixing the highway themselves so they are probably using 3.33% to 5% max.
